Basic Operations MATLAB matrix

%% 矩阵基本操作
% A = rand(5)%随机生成5行5列0-1的数
% B = det(A)%矩阵的行列式
% r = rank(A)%求矩阵的秩
% tr = trace(A)%求矩阵的迹
%% 向量的范数
% V = [1,2,3,4,5]
% v1 = norm(V,1)%元素和(1-范数)
% v2 = norm(V)%平方和开根号(2-范数)
% vinf = norm(V,inf)%最大(无穷-范数)
%% 矩阵的范数及其计算函数
% A = rand(5)%随机生成5行5列0-1的数
% v1 = norm(A,1)%元素和(1-范数)
% v2 = norm(A)%平方和开根号(2-范数)
% vinf = norm(A,inf)%最大(无穷-范数)
%% 矩阵的条件数 越接近1越好,元素微小扰动影响小
% A = rand(5)%随机生成5行5列0-1的数
% c1 = cond(A,1)%元素和(1-范数)
% c2 = cond(A)%平方和开根号(2-范数)
% cinf = cond(A,inf)%最大(无穷-范数)
%% 矩阵的特征值与特征向量
% A = rand(5)%随机生成5行5列0-1的数
% [V,D] = eig(A)%V特征向量列,D特征值
%% 矩阵的超越函数
% A = [4,2;3,6];
% B = sqrtm(A)%计算矩阵平方根
% C = logm(A)%计算矩阵对数
% D = expm(A)%计算矩阵指数
% E = funm(A,'exp')%计算矩阵函数fun

Author: ChenBD

Published 145 original articles · won praise 213 · views 10000 +

Guess you like

Origin blog.csdn.net/s0302017/article/details/103845870